1001puzzle / Seeds, set of spice seeds, mint, lemon balm, basil

$10.5

1001puzzle / Seeds, set of spice seeds, mint, lemon balm, basil

250 in stock

SKU: O-33165125 Categories: , Tags: , , , , , ,